“More” is a popular song with music by Alex Alstone and lyrics by Tom Glazer, published in 1956. The best-known version of the song was recorded by Perry Como on May 8, 1956, alongside, Mitchell Ayres and His Orchestra and The Ray Charles Singers.

Who sang the song More in the 70s? “More, More, More” is a song written by Gregg Diamond and recorded by American disco artist Andrea True (credited to her recording project “Andrea True Connection”). It was released in February 1976 and became her signature track and one of the most popular songs of the disco era.

What song does more than a woman sample?

Complex journalist Lauren Nostro said “More Than a Woman” mixes “pop, electro, and a mesmerizing mid tempo hip-hop feel, which allowed Aaliyah’s delicate vocals to take the spotlight”. The song contains an initially-uncredited sample from the Arabic song “Alouli Ansa” by Syrian singer Mayada El Hennawy.

What song samples Steal My Sunshine?

An indie pop and dance-pop song, “Steal My Sunshine” features siblings Marc and Sharon Costanzo trading lead vocals. The song’s instrumental backing track is a sample of Andrea True Connection’s 1976 single “More, More, More”.

What does Drake 6 God tattoo mean?

On his forearm, praying hands and the number, 6. Drake famously refers to himself as the “6 God,” a reference to his Toronto roots (area code 416). Beneath that, a portrait of Denzel Washington from the 1990 film, Mo’ Better Blues.

What song did Normani sample from Aaliyah?

Normani’s single “Wild Side” recently dropped, attracting attention with its prominent sample of Aaliyah’s hit song “One in a Million.” But the late singer’s uncle said this week that Normani wasn’t granted permission to sample the song.
